1. Sarah Paulson

Sarah Paulson is one of the most recognizable faces of "American Horror Story," known for her versatile and powerful performances. She first appeared in the show's first season, "Murder House," as the medium Billie Dean Howard.

Paulson’s portrayal of Lana Winters in "Asylum" is arguably one of her most acclaimed roles, showcasing her ability to convey deep emotional turmoil and resilience. Her performance earned her a Primetime Emmy Award, solidifying her position as a leading actress in the horror genre.

2. Evan Peters

Evan Peters has become a fan favorite for his dynamic range and ability to embody complex characters. His roles in AHS often showcase his unique talent for blending humor with horror.

Peters' characters, including Tate Langdon in "Murder House" and Kit Walker in "Asylum," have left a lasting impression on viewers. His portrayal of Tate, a troubled teenager with a dark past, remains one of the most talked-about performances in the series.

4. Kathy Bates

Kathy Bates is a celebrated actress known for her powerful performances and ability to embody characters with depth. In AHS, she has taken on various roles, most notably Delphine LaLaurie in "Coven."

Bates' portrayal of the sadistic character received widespread acclaim, and her performance in "Freak Show" as Ethel Darling further showcased her versatility.

5. Lily Rabe

Lily Rabe has made a name for herself in the AHS franchise, known for her captivating performances and ability to portray complex characters. Her role as Sister Mary Eunice in "Asylum" remains one of her standout performances.

Rabe's portrayal of various characters throughout the series has earned her a dedicated fanbase and recognition for her talent.

6. Frances Conroy

Frances Conroy is a veteran actress whose work in AHS has showcased her incredible range. Known for her portrayal of Moira O'Hara in "Murder House," Conroy's character added depth and intrigue to the storyline.

Her role as Myrtle Snow in "Coven" further highlighted her talent, making her a beloved character among fans.

7. Angela Bassett

Angela Bassett is an iconic actress whose presence in AHS has been nothing short of remarkable. Her role as Marie Laveau in "Coven" allowed her to showcase her powerful persona and strong character.

Bassett's performances have garnered praise and solidified her status as one of the leading figures in the entertainment industry.
